Harris ImageLinks
Harris ImageLinks (part of Harris Mission Systems / Geospatial Solutions Group) will be at ITEC to answer any questions and highlight some of the latest Harris advanced geospatial capabilities and products.  This includes high-resolution DEMs (digital elevation models), materials classification for sensor simulation, and 3D building model extraction available from Lidar, aerial and/or satellite data.  Harris now has over 500 Harbors and 500+ airport datasets in-house.  Harris will also introduce Active Catalog to the European community which is a geospatial data management system with advanced search and retrieval capabilities.  Harris will also showcase MET (Multi-image Exploitation Tool), an advanced image processing software package with nearly a 20-year history supporting thousands of government users which has been recently approved as an exportable COTS package.

TerraSim
With more and more activity in Europe, TerraSim will be at ITEC 2010 to present new TerraTools features. This will include the new Steel Beasts Pro and OpenSceneGraph database generation capabilities, new VBS2 export enhancements, and live networking of JointSAF with VBS2 and Steel Beasts Pro using LVC Game. Demonstrations will also include presentations of TerraTools exporters for VR-Forces, VR-Vantage, VBS2, Steel Beasts Pro, and Xtract database reuse for CTDB, OpenFlight and OneSAF OTF. The new time-saving TerraTools 3.8 OmniWizard and parallel database construction will also be showcased.



TrianGraphics
TrianGraphics will be at ITEC 2010 to showcase Trian3D Builder 3.0, the recently released new version of their database generation system. Trian3D Builder is intuitive and allows the quick generation of generic and geotypical terrains. The new VBS2 exporter offers the ability to generate georeferenced terrains of arbitrary size for the VBS2 simulation platform in addition to various other supported export formats (OSG, FLT/MFT, GDB, FBX, DAE...). TrianGraphics will also present the Trian3D Roads, Airport and Building Modules, as well as additional new features such as the support for multiple terrain grids.

Vortex
Vortex provides vehicle dynamics, robotics and heavy-equipment interactive simulation solutions and services to companies throughout the real-time visual-simulation world. Vortex expertise puts high-fidelity behaviour in motion for training simulators, mission rehearsal, serious games, and virtual prototyping. Vortex has been used in hundreds of training simulations from EOD robots and battle tank trainers to convoy training applications. At ITEC, the Vortex Lunar Electric Rover Simulator will demonstrate Vortex simulation capabilities for robotics, vehicle dynamics and deformable terrain.
